Coastal Cabana is a lovely shade of blue-green and I had so many ideas for this project. However, I have been looking at my shelves and trying to use stamps that haven't had enough ink lately and Beauty of the Deep popped out at me.


It sat for a day or two before I decided to go back to the past to try out the retiform technique again. It really is a lot of fun and blending brushes make it so much easier than it used to be. I grabbed a pile of blue and green inks including Coastal Cabana and made a start.


Maybe I should have photographed the process as I worked, but it is something you can google and learn that way. I masked a small area and blended ink before stamping with the same shade and a stamp (or two) from Beauty of the Deep. You move the masks around creating geometric patches to colour and stamp. 


I find starting with a full quarter sheet of Basic White is best because it can be trimmed back afterwards to use the best portion of your artwork. To finish off I stamped 'Hey.' from Saying Hey and diecut 'friend' from Friends For Life dies to make a notecard to post to a friend.

When a new catalogue comes out, everyone is always excited to choose their favourites and order. Beautiful Balloons was in my pre-order and I made a couple of cards and then put it aside. This week it was time to play with it again.


To make the Azure Afternoon card go further, I have only heat embossed a sentiment onto a narrow strip. Inside I stamped a balloon, I stamped 'sparkles onto the Boho Blue balloons and the frame is also stamped in Azure Afternoon.


The Azure Afternoon is looking a bit too much like Boho Blue in these photos, but I think my second card might show the colour off a bit better.


Jacque Williams, a New Zealand demonstrator shared this simple wiper card on her blog which inspired a rush of creativity from me. I made  so many different cards using this fold but actually this one didn't work out so well. The pinata kept getting caught up on the flags, so I changed it onto a wobble spring.
